I could see him from the knees up. And the only difference was, when he was in the casket, the undertaker, who knew him, combed his hair the way he used to comb it when he was younger, parted on the side here and all pulled over. As my father got older, the hair got thinner here, so he used to part it down the centre and put it this way. That's the way his hair was combed when I saw him standing at the bed. So I got a shock. And I said, "What do you want? What matter?" And then, before he would ...'. • ..'' ' the latterY" And then, betore he would have aid anything, I said, "Are you saved?" He said, "Yes, you know I'd be saved." And then I said again, "What do you want?" He said, "A bill." "Oh," I said, "no, there isn't," He said, "Yes, there is," I said, "Where?" He said, "Malcolm Dan Mac? Lellan' s. $16,25, And," he said, "the bill is 25 years old," By this time, I had lost my fear. And I turned my eyes off him, because I was get? ting ready to ask questions about the oth? er world, I put the book down on the table, and turned. There was nothing there. (Oh, he didn't stay and talk to you.) No, As soon as he got the message across, he dis? appeared. Well, I didn't sleep all night, I just sat there and smoked cigarettes. Dawn came, I went out and said Mass. So then I went to see MacLellan, and I told MacLellan, And I said, "I had an awful experience last night," I said, "I don't believe in this," I said, "There's only one other case quite similar. I'm going to go to Inverness and," I said, "if there's a bill in Inverness, then I've got to believe it. If not," I said, "I'm going on to Halifax to see a psychiatrist." So it was a Saturday morn? ing. He said, "Go ahead." So I came home, and I went over to the mer? chant. And I called him aside. And I told him what happened. "No, no, no," he said, "no, no. Your father is even," "Well," I said, "there's something, I'd like to-- have you got old bills?" "Oh," he said, "well, yeah, yeah, yeah," "Well," I said, "I want to go through them," He said, "Wait a minute. I'm kind of busy now. But at dinnertime there'll be a lull, I'll go with you," So he took me upstairs to an old office he had, and we went through every bloody bill--no, nothing. So he said, "Look at that!"
